Unlocking Pumpkin Yields with Algorithmic Precision

Farmers are increasingly turning to cutting-edge algorithms to maximize their pumpkin yields. By analyzing parameters such as soil composition, weather patterns, and plant growth stages, these systems can provide accurate recommendations for enhancing cultivation practices. This data-driven approach allows farmers to increase pumpkin production while cutting input costs and environmental impact. The result is a greater fruitful harvest for all.
